The Nations N324xx are general-purpose microcontroller based on the Arm® Cortex®-M4 core.

Flash Banks

Internal Flash

Flash Bank Base address Size J-Link Support
Main Flash 0x08000000 up to 128 KB YES.png
Option Byte 0x1FFFF800 20 B YES.png

Device Specific Handling

Reset

  • The devices uses normal Cortex-M reset, no special handling necessary, like described here.
